Output 352c65039e93db28a7860a313cfd2c30c9fbf2a210fc2ae8221663c27589aabf:1

value
1416947
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d39ef30e54f832e4409bc656c032e689d92d3f7a OP_EQUAL
address
3Lyxv29DRcBdJKgHkPv637fm4EiK7qVnGc
transaction
352c65039e93db28a7860a313cfd2c30c9fbf2a210fc2ae8221663c27589aabf
confirmations
357650
spent
true